Kinross Road Runners
Kinross Road Runners were represented at six races over the last four weeks at venues ranging from Knockhill to Aberfeldy. The first race was Forfar 10K on 20 August where Geoff Bilton ran 49:45, Sue Whisler ran 56:03 and Norman Smith finished in 59:17. This was followed 3 days later by the Graham Clark Memorial Race at Knockhill. Man power replaced horse power as runners raced round 3 laps of the race track, a distance of 4.5 miles. Steve Crawford finished 32nd in 24:17, Andrew Johns was 66th in 27:33, husband and wife team Chris and John Myerscough crossed the line together in 29:31.
Twelve Kinross Road Runners ran Perth ‘Two Inches’ 10K on 27th August. Judith Dobson was 58th in 43:48 closely followed by Andrew Johns who was 62nd in 44:42,
Gordon Donnachie was 77th in 45.59, John Myerscough finished 4 places and 16 secs. ahead of wife Christine in 48.00, Roger Stark was 110th in 48.25, Isabel Carmichael was 120th 48.52, Gillian Lopez’s time is missing from the results but she finished ahead of Valerie Findlay who was 152nd in 50.40. Sue Whisler and Norman Smith both ran faster at Perth than at Forfar to finish in 54.02 and 57.47 and Catriona Berry crossed the line in 1.02.43.
Andrews Johns completed his 3rd run in two weeks in the company of Douglas Leitch at Glasgow Half Marathon on 3rd September. Although they crossed the finish line together chip timing gave Andrew a slightly faster time than Douglas as he started further back. Andrew finished in a personal best time of 1:36:44 and Douglas’s time was 1:37:27.
Douglas also ran Aberfeldy Half marathon the following weekend along with 5 other Kinross Road Runners. Running conditions at Aberfeldy weren’t so good as the weather was warm and sunny in contrast to the wet weather the previous weekend. The different weather conditions and the slightly long course (rumoured to be 0.5 miles long) resulted in a slower time for Douglas of 1:44:43, Judith Dobson was 7th lady and 3rd FV45 in 1:39:57 followed by Isabel Carmichael who was 10th lady and 4th FV45 in 1:50:57. John Myerscough was pleased to finish his first Half Marathon in years uninjured in 2:03:30 and was closely followed by a veteran of many races Bill Nouilllan in 2:05:33. Sandy MacCalman prefers hill running so made a rare appearance in a road race and finished in 2:18:29.
Andrew Johns, Isabel Carmichael, Sue Whisler, Geoff Bilton, Judith Dobson and Steve Crawford all ran in the popular Stirling 10K the following Sunday (10th September). Steve Crawford and Andrew Johns both ran personal best times of 38:40 and 43:30 mins on this flat course which starts and finishes at Stirling Albion football ground.. Judith Dobson was 3rd FV45 in 42:48, Isabel Carmichael ran 48:30, Geoff Bilton ran 49:18, Sue Whisler finished in 54:48 and Catriona McRobbie finished in 66:18.
